Possible origins:
-Rakshasha flavoured tiefling.
-Foreign people from a distant continent. Means you don't have to have them present as a race/civilization, just rare displaced individuals.
-Druid sect that practices partial shape-shifting to honour their totemic animal.
-Person who got cursed for poking an ancient cat goddess idol.
-A wizard did it. Hey, it works for owl-bears, why not cat-men?

Other suggestions:
-Discuss things with him openly. Have him clarify what he wants and why. Try to find a way to fulfil it within your limitation. If he's willing to be reasonable - good sign; if he spergs the fuck out - shut him down.
-Float the idea of playing a male catperson.
-Make it clear you don't want fanservice trash like 'Oh no I've gone into heat' or 'What are clothes, teehee' in your game.
TL;DR: Talk about it, see if he spergs or is reasonable.

>In ages past, the Purrhya were a tribe of men who followed the totem of the Lynx
>Then came the breaking of the world, when the Edenic Paradise age came to a cataclysmic end
>Many tribes of man abandoned their totems in desperation, turning to deities or demons for help
>The Purrhya were different, prefering to beseech their totem alone for aid
>Fortunately, Lynx was clever totem, and saved his tribe by changing them into his form so they were better prepared to survive the end of the World That Was
>Not every Purrhya appreciated being reduced to a cat, and after the cataclysm and rebirth of the world, many demanded their human forms be returned
>This insulted Lynx, who assented to the request, but cursed the Purrhya to be forever trapped between two forms-never to truly return to manhood, but not to remain in the form of a lynx
>Today, one might mistake a Purrhya for a human from afar, but upon closer inspection the differences become more apparent
>A Purrhya's eyes resemble that of cat's, their teeth and nails are sharp for hunting prey- men even grow mustaches that look reminiscent of feline whiskers
>Every Purrhya also keeps a lynx pelt somewhere on their person or hidden in their home
>This pelt isn't from any old lynx, however, as each pelt is the Purrhya's second skin, which they must where in the form of a lynx for at least 4 hours a day
>When in this form a Purrhya is no different from a regular lynx, save that their mind remains intact
>Should a Purrhya fail to wear their second skin for the required time, they die in slow agony as their human skin still sloughs off

>Legends say that not all of the ancestors demanded their human form back from Lynx
>One cannot help but wonder what became of that race of lynxes who retained the cleverness of men but did not insult their patron

The standard background for anime catpeople, when they have one, is "artificial race created as soldiers, who are now widely discriminated against and presumed to be thieves".

The "warlock who gained beastly traits as part of their pact" route also works.

Finally, there's the mythological "animals who learned to disguise themselves as humans but have trouble hiding their ears". For cats you can expect necromancy powers, including will-o-wisps, creating undead, and eating dead enemies to steal their forms.

Another thing that seems weirdly common is
>Half-beastfolk look mostly human, except for maybe weird eyes, hair or nails. Under certain conditions, however, their beast half can start rejecting their human half, sending them into a berserk rage where they temporarily transform into a full beastfolk with exaggerated claws and fangs (or in extreme cases, a giant version of the animal their beastfolk parent was based on).
